Sweep Alarm Clock EN 1738
O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S
1. Remove the battery cover of the alarm clock to insert the batteries. Please pay attention to
the correct polarity. To enjoy the alarm clock for a long time, please use an alkaline battery
of the type AA/LR6/Mignon. Close the battery cover again.
2. Set the exact time using the time setting knob.
3. Turn the alarm setting knob to set the desired alarm time.
4. To activate the alarm time, turn the alarm knob to ON or up.
5. To activate the snooze function, press the snooze button (LIGHT/SNOOZE) when the alarm
sounds. After approx. 4 minutes the alarm signal sounds again. This snooze button can be
pressed several times.
6. To switch off the alarm clock completely, set the alarm button to OFF or down.
7. Illumination: Press the LIGHT/SNOZZE button to illuminate the clock face or the alarm clock.
Please note: Frequent use of the light will reduce battery life.
Maintenance:
1. The batteries should be replaced as soon as the display or alarm becomes dim. Store the
alarm clock without batteries when not in use.
2. Use dry cleaning cloths to clean the alarm clock.
3. Do not use aggressive cleaning agents.

Battery return
Batteries must not be disposed of with household waste. The consumer is legally obliged to dispose of
batteries in accordance with use, e.g. in the public sector,collection points or where such batteries are sold.
Batteries containing harmful substances are marked with the symbol "crossed out dustbin" and one of the
chemical symbols Cd (= battery contains cadmium), Hg (= battery contains mercury) or Pb (= battery contains
lead).
